📖Generation guide

Launch • 2021-2022

The initial launch of the Mach-E saw trims such as Standard Range, Extended Range, GT, and GT Performance Edition, manufactured with LG Chem NCM cells. This generation faced early OTA update issues impacting one-pedal driving and range estimation.

Mid-cycle • 2023+

Beginning in 2023, the Mach-E transitioned to CATL LFP cells for Standard Range models. The rollout of the NACS adapter in 2024 and the introduction of the 2024 Rally trim with enhanced ride height and Brembo brakes highlight its evolution.

Known issues by generation

The Mustang Mach-E has faced several model-specific issues throughout its generations. For the Launch generation (2021-2022), common problems include the 12V auxiliary battery drain issue leading to NHTSA recalls 22V-388 and 22V-389 specifically affecting the GT Performance Edition. Additionally, there have been reports of charging-port latch failures where the CCS port can become stuck closed. OTA updates have also led to challenges such as one-pedal driving calibration inconsistencies. Moving into the mid-cycle models from 2023 onwards, retrofitting for BlueCruise hands-free hardware has been a focal point, while new features and battery technologies continue to enhance the overall driving experience.
